For efficiency, you have to consider the energy or work that you get out of the machine, compared to the energy or work that you put into the machine. Its what you get out, divided by what you put in. By multiplying the result by 100, you should then get the efficiency expressed as a percentage, which is the normal way of describe how efficient a machine or process is. efficiency = (Work out/Work in) x 100 Sometimes you are given the efficiency in a problem, but then have to calculate either the work out or work in, so then its just a case of rearranging the equation above.

The equation to calculate the work done is: Work done (J) = force applied (n) x distance moved of force (m)
To calculate work done on an object one needs to use the following equation; work = force x distance or W = F x d
To calculate 200 J of work in 20 seconds would be to calculate the power. You would use the equation power equals work divided by time. This gives you 10 W of power.
